| Summary | 0036971: CVE-2026-33517: Stored HTML Injection / XSS in Tag Delete Confirmation via Unescaped Tag Name | ||||
| Description | MantisBT renders the tag delete confirmation message with attacker-controlled tag names inserted into the HTML response without output escaping. In the French locale, the tag_delete_message string contains %1$s, and tag_delete.php:52 passes the tag name directly into sprintf(). The resulting message is then printed by helper_ensure_confirmed():427 without HTML escaping. Tag names are not sanitized against HTML/JavaScript content by tag_name_is_valid():261, which only blocks +, -, and the configured tag separator. In the tested localhost build, the injected <script> reached the DOM but execution was blocked by the application’s Content Security Policy. As a result, this is confirmed as a stored HTML/script injection sink, and may become executable XSS where CSP is absent, weakened, disabled or bypassed. | ||||

Thanks for the report @ninjasec. I confirm the vulnerability, which was introduced in 2.28.0 by MantisBT master d6890320, when the language string was modified to include the tag name (see 0022607). The problem is not language-specific, it's just that not all languages have been updated to reflect the above-mentioned change in the master English language file.
